William J. "Bill" Satchell (1879-1969), a weaver by trade, performed as "The Great Marvel" staring out doing Houdini type escapes.[1][2]
Biography
Satchell was native of Lancaster,England, but came to the U.S. at the age of 10. In 1938 he moved to Warwick Rhode Island and had been employed in several mills before retiring.[3]
Mr. Satchell was one of the early members of the I.B.M., joining in 1923 as member No. 260. He was charter member of I.B.M. Ring 44 in Providence, Rhode Island and served as it's President in the 1930s.[4]
